BMW K 1300 GT 2010 specs

Latest motor bike specifications and pictures for the 2010 BMW K 1300 GT.



BMW K 1300 GT 2010 motorcycle info

Main Detail

Make
BMW
Model
K 1300 GT
Year
2010
Category
Sport touring

Performance and Speed

Power to Weight Ratio
0.6205 HP/kg
Torque
135.00 Nm (13.8 kgf-m or 99.6 ft.lbs) @ 8000

Dimensions and Weight

Dry Weight
255.0 kg / 562.2 pounds
Overall Height
1,438 mm / 56.6 inches
Overall Length
2,318 mm / 91.3 inches
Overall Width
965 mm / 38.0 inches
Trail
112 mm / 4.4 inches
Kerb Weight
288.0 kg / 634.9 pounds
Wheelbase
1,572 mm / 61.9 inches

Engine and Exhaust

Bore / Stroke
80.0 x 64.3 mm / 3.1 x 2.5 inches
Engine Capacity
1293.00 cc / 78.90 cubic inches
Compression
13.0:1
Engine Type
In-line four, four-stroke
Starter
Electric
Valves / Cylinder
4
Exhaust system
Closed-loop 3-way catalytic converter, emission standard EU-3

Transmission (Gearbox) and Final Drive

Transmission Type
Shaft drive (cardan)
Gearbox
6-speed
Clutch
Multiple-disc clutch in oil bath, hydraulically operated

Fuel and Emission Standards

Fuel System
Injection. Electronic intake pipe injection/digital engine management including knock sensor (BMS-K)
Fuel Consumption
5.00 litres/100 km (20.0 km/l or 47.04 mpg)
Fuel Capacity
24.00 litres / 6.34 gallons
Reserve Fuel Capacity
4.00 litres / 1.06 gallons
Greenhouse Gases
116.0 CO

Suspension

Front Suspension
BMW Motorrad Duolever
Front Suspension Travel
115 mm / 4.5 inches
Front Wheel Travel
115 mm / 4.5 inches
Rear Suspension
Cast aluminium single-sided swing arm with BMW Motorrad Paralever
Rear Wheel Travel
135 mm / 5.3 inches

Tires and Rims

Front Tire Dimensions
120/70-ZR17
Rear Tire Dimensions
180/55-ZR17

Brakes

Front Brakes
Double disc
Front Brake Diameter
320 mm / 12.6 inches
Rear Brakes
Single disc
Rear Brake Diameter
294 mm / 11.6 inches

Notes, Comments and Warranty Information

Colour Options
Red, beige, blue
